Форум программистов «Весельчак У»
  *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

  • Рекомендуем проверить настройки временной зоны в вашем профиле (страница "Внешний вид форума", пункт "Часовой пояс:").
  • У нас больше нет рассылок. Если вам приходят письма от наших бывших рассылок mail.ru и subscribe.ru, то знайте, что это не мы рассылаем.
   Начало  
Наши сайты
Помощь Поиск Календарь Почта Войти Регистрация  
 
Страниц: [1]   Вниз
  Печать  
Автор Тема: кэширование рисунков.  (Прочитано 12027 раз)
0 Пользователей и 1 Гость смотрят эту тему.
schnibbl
Гость
« : 20-05-2005 11:50 » 

что для этого надо делать ? у меня щас есть часть где фоном идет картинка размноженная (полосочка гиф. размер 1х20 пикселов) занимае тсовсем ничего, но у объекта есть свойства при наведении мыши, и вот каждый раз этот рисуночек перекачивается с сайта причем очень медленно, как сделат ьтак чтобы он во временные файлы поместился ? или эти тормоза из-за бесплатного хоста ? (грузиться ну очень медленно)
Записан
RXL
Технический
Администратор

Offline Offline
Пол: Мужской

WWW
« Ответ #1 : 20-05-2005 14:17 » 

На бесплатном быстрее всего никак не сделаешь.
Вообще-то, хранить-не хранить в кеше и сколько решает сам браузер, а сервер лишь выдает ему рекомендации. Конечно, если эти рекомендации ошибочны, то и толковый браузер будет тупить.
Записан

... мы преодолеваем эту трудность без синтеза распределенных прототипов. (с) Жуков М.С.
schnibbl
Гость
« Ответ #2 : 23-05-2005 06:37 » 

ну меня просто факт этот смущает, есть ячейка таблицы фон которой вот эта хрень (1х20 точек. гиф) и почему он каждый раз перерисовывается причем ну очень медленно, если фон больше неменяется ? меняется только наличие или отсутствие рамки у ячейки по наведению мышки.
Записан
schnibbl
Гость
« Ответ #3 : 15-07-2005 09:09 » 

Новый вопрос в добавок к прозвучавшим здесь.
Если изображение разбито на несколько кусочков - отображение браузером происходит по мере загрузки кусочков изображения, как средствами html или еще чего так пометить img чтобы браузер сначала всё целиком загрузил а уж потом выложил сразу всю составную картинку.
Записан
RXL
Технический
Администратор

Offline Offline
Пол: Мужской

WWW
« Ответ #4 : 15-07-2005 16:02 » 

Никак - отображение страницы целиком на совести браузера.
Только старые версии IE не показывали картинку до полной загрузки.
Записан

... мы преодолеваем эту трудность без синтеза распределенных прототипов. (с) Жуков М.С.
nikedeforest
Команда клуба

ru
Offline Offline
Пол: Мужской

« Ответ #5 : 15-08-2005 16:54 » 

Вопрос противоположный теме, но все-таки решил задать здесь.
Можно-ли как-нибудь сделать так, чтобы браузер  не кэшировал страницу?
Записан

ещё один вопрос ...
RXL
Технический
Администратор

Offline Offline
Пол: Мужской

WWW
« Ответ #6 : 16-08-2005 10:33 » 

Можно - на стороне сервера или в прокси должно ыть задано не кешировать.
Записан

... мы преодолеваем эту трудность без синтеза распределенных прототипов. (с) Жуков М.С.
nikedeforest
Команда клуба

ru
Offline Offline
Пол: Мужской

« Ответ #7 : 16-08-2005 11:24 » 

Как мне сделать, чтобы страница не кэшировалась, на РНР или HTML?
Записан

ещё один вопрос ...
MOPO3
Ай да дэдушка! Вах...
Команда клуба

lt
Offline Offline
Пол: Мужской
Холадна аднака!


WWW
« Ответ #8 : 16-08-2005 15:04 » new

Находу точно не вспомню, но вроде так :

PHP
Код:
<?php
header 
("Pragma: no-cache"); 
header ("Cache-Control: no-cache, must-revalidate, max_age=0"); 
header ("Expires: 0"); 
?>


HTML (между тэгами <head> и </head>)
Код:
<META HTTP-EQUIV="Cache-Control" CONTENT="no-cache">
<META HTTP-EQUIV="Pragma" CONTENT="no-cache">
<META HTTP-EQUIV="Expires" CONTENT="0">
Записан

MCP, MCAD, MCTS:Win, MCTS:Web
Страниц: [1]   Вверх
  Печать  
 

Powered by SMF 1.1.21 | SMF © 2015, Simple Machines